Why Choose a 12×8 Garage Door?
Before diving into the technical details, it is crucial to understand why this specific dimension is gaining popularity among US homeowners. A 12-foot width provides ample clearance for vehicles that exceed the standard 7-foot width of traditional single-car doors.
Ideal for Larger Vehicles
Standard single-car garage doors are typically 8 or 9 feet wide. However, many modern full-size trucks, SUVs, and even small RVs require more breathing room. A 12 ft wide by 8 ft tall garage door allows for:
- Easy entry and exit without scratching side mirrors.
- Space for additional storage items like bicycles or lawn equipment on the sides.
- Better ventilation when the door is partially open.
The “Double Single” Alternative
Many homeowners consider installing two separate 8-foot or 9-foot doors. However, a single 12-foot door often provides a cleaner architectural look and eliminates the center pillar that can obstruct visibility and access. It creates a grander entrance to your workshop or garage space.
Material Options: Steel, Wood, or Aluminum?
When selecting a 12 ft wide by 8 ft tall garage door, the material you choose will impact durability, maintenance, and price. Here is a breakdown of the most common options available in the US market.
1. Steel Doors
Steel is the most popular choice for residential garage doors due to its affordability and durability.
- Pros: Low maintenance, resistant to warping, available in various insulated R-values.
- Cons: Prone to denting if hit by heavy objects; can rust if the coating is compromised.
- Best For: Homeowners looking for a cost-effective, long-lasting solution.
2. Wood Doors
For those seeking a classic, high-end aesthetic, wood doors offer unmatched beauty.
- Pros: Natural insulation properties, customizable stains and finishes, increases curb appeal.
- Cons: High maintenance (requires regular sealing/painting), expensive, susceptible to weather damage.
- Best For: Historic homes or luxury properties where aesthetics are the top priority.
3. Aluminum and Glass
Modern homes often feature aluminum frames with tempered glass inserts.
- Pros: Lightweight, resistant to corrosion, allows natural light into the garage.
- Cons: Poor insulation unless specifically designed with thermal breaks, higher cost than basic steel.
- Best For: Contemporary homes and workshops where visibility and light are desired.

Cost Breakdown: What to Expect
One of the most common questions homeowners ask is, “How much does a 12 ft wide by 8 ft tall garage door cost?” The price varies significantly based on material, brand, and installation complexity.
Average Price Range
- Basic Non-Insulated Steel: $800 โ $1,200
- Insulated Steel (R-12 to R-16): $1,200 โ $2,500
- Wood Composite: $2,500 โ $4,000
- Custom Wood/High-End Aluminum: $4,000+
Note: These prices typically include the door itself but may not include professional installation, which can add another $300โ$800 depending on your location and the complexity of the job.
Factors Influencing Cost
- Insulation Level: Higher R-values improve energy efficiency but increase the price. If your garage is attached to your home, investing in insulation is highly recommended.
- Windows and Hardware: Adding windows, decorative handles, or upgrading to heavy-duty springs will increase the total cost.
- Brand Reputation: Established brands like Clopay, Amarr, and Overhead Door often command a premium due to their warranty and reliability.
Installation Considerations for a 12×8 Door
Installing a 12 ft wide by 8 ft tall garage door is not a DIY project for beginners. Due to the width and weight, proper alignment and tensioning of the springs are critical for safety and longevity.
Step-by-Step Overview
- Measure the Opening: Ensure the rough opening is exactly 12 feet wide and 8 feet tall. Check for squareness; if the frame is out of square, the door may not operate smoothly.
- Remove the Old Door: Carefully disconnect the opener and release tension from the old springs. Warning: Torsion springs are under extreme tension and can cause serious injury if handled incorrectly.
- Install Tracks and Brackets: Secure the vertical tracks to the wall studs and the horizontal tracks to the ceiling joists. Use a level to ensure perfect alignment.
- Hang the Door Sections: Assemble the door panels and hang them on the rollers within the tracks.
- Install Springs and Cables: Attach the torsion spring system to the header bracket above the door. Wind the springs to the correct tension based on the doorโs weight.
- Test and Adjust: Manually lift the door to check for balance. It should stay in place when lifted halfway. Connect the automatic opener and test the safety sensors.

Maintenance Tips for Longevity
To keep your 12 ft wide by 8 ft tall garage door functioning smoothly for years, regular maintenance is key.
- Lubricate Moving Parts: Every six months, apply a silicone-based lubricant to rollers, hinges, and springs. Avoid WD-40 as it can attract dust and gum up the mechanism.
- Inspect Weather Stripping: Check the rubber seals at the bottom and sides of the door. Replace them if they are cracked or brittle to maintain insulation and keep pests out.
- Check Spring Tension: If the door feels heavy or doesnโt stay open, the springs may need adjustment. Call a professional for this task.
- Clean the Surface: Wash steel doors with mild soap and water to prevent dirt buildup. For wood doors, inspect the finish annually and re-seal as needed.
FAQ Section
Q1: Will a 12 ft wide door fit in my existing garage opening?
A: Not necessarily. Standard single-car openings are usually 8 or 9 feet wide. To install a 12 ft wide by 8 ft tall garage door, you will likely need to widen the structural opening, which involves framing work and potentially modifying the exterior siding. Consult a contractor to assess feasibility.
Q2: Is an 8-foot height sufficient for an RV?
A: For most Class B and smaller Class C RVs, 8 feet is sufficient. However, larger Class A motorhomes often exceed 8 feet in height. Always measure your specific vehicleโs height, including roof vents and air conditioning units, before finalizing the door height.
Q3: Do I need a special opener for a 12-foot door?
A: Yes, a 12-foot door is heavier and wider than standard doors. You will need a garage door opener with sufficient horsepower (typically ยฝ HP or higher) and a rail length that accommodates the wider track system. Belt-drive openers are recommended for quieter operation.
Q4: Can I insulate a 12×8 garage door?
A: Absolutely. Most steel and composite doors come with optional insulation packages. Look for polyurethane foam injection for the highest R-value and structural rigidity. Insulating your door helps regulate temperature if your garage is used as a workspace or is attached to your home.
Q5: How long does it take to install a 12×8 garage door?
A: Professional installation typically takes between 4 to 6 hours. This includes removing the old door, preparing the opening, installing the new door, and testing the system. If structural modifications are needed, the timeline will extend accordingly.
